Worm Gear for Agricultural Machinery
Introduction
Worm gear for agricultural machinery plays a crucial role in the efficient operation of various agricultural equipment. It is a type of gear mechanism that consists of a worm screw and a worm wheel. The worm screw, also known as the input shaft, is a spiral gear, while the worm wheel, or the output shaft, is a cylindrical gear. This unique configuration allows worm gears to offer high gear ratios and provide smooth and quiet operation. Performance Characteristics of Worm Gear
- 1. High Gear Ratios: Worm gears are known for their ability to achieve high gear ratios, allowing for precise speed control and torque transmission.
- 2. Compact Design: The compact design of worm gears enables them to be used in applications with limited space.
- 3. Smooth and Quiet Operation: Due to the sliding action between the worm screw and the worm wheel, worm gears offer smooth and quiet operation.

How to Maintain Worm Gear
Proper maintenance of worm gear is essential to ensure its longevity and optimal performance. The following maintenance practices should be followed:
- 1. Regular Equipment Inspection: Perform regular inspections to identify any signs of wear, damage, or misalignment.
- 2. Cleaning and Corrosion Prevention: Keep the worm gear clean and apply appropriate coatings to prevent corrosion.
- 3. Lubrication and Greasing: Apply the recommended lubricants and greases to reduce friction and ensure smooth operation.
- 4. Replacement of Worn Components: Replace any worn or damaged components to maintain the efficiency and functionality of the worm gear.
- 5. Load Monitoring: Monitor the load and operating conditions to prevent overloading and ensure safe operation of the worm gear.

Q: How can I determine the gear ratio of a worm gear system?
A: The gear ratio of a worm gear system is determined by dividing the number of teeth on the worm wheel by the number of threads on the worm screw.
